Analysis of parallel connection of Rosen type piezoelectric transformers

2004 
Single layer Rosen type piezoelectric transformer is an attractive component for portable high voltage applications because of its small thickness and low cost. It is favorable for applications such as LCD backlight cold cathode fluorescent lamp converters where thickness is an important feature. In general piezoelectric transformer can produce low output power only and this is a major drawback in many applications where more power is needed. A promising solution is parallel connection of several transformers. In this paper parallel connection of piezoelectric transformers is investigated and discussed. A simple model is produced which allows representation of characteristics of parallel Rosen type piezoelectric transformers. Comparisons with experimental result verify the model. This model provides engineers with a simple and useful design tool.
